Warning: file_get_contents(/data/phpspider/zhask/data//catemap/8/mysql/61.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Can';不要创建MySQL视图_Mysql_Sql_View - Fatal编程技术网

Can';不要创建MySQL视图

Can';不要创建MySQL视图,mysql,sql,view,Mysql,Sql,View,我运行此SQL代码来创建视图,但这不起作用: Create VIEW as select c.ID_CAPTEUR as ID_CAPTEUR, d.ID_CAPTURE as ID_CAPTURE, d.VALEUR_CAPTURE as valeur, d.DATE_CAPTURE, t.INTITULE_TYPE_CAPTURE as TYPE_CAPTURE, z.INTITULE_Z

我运行此SQL代码来创建视图,但这不起作用:

Create VIEW as
    select
        c.ID_CAPTEUR as ID_CAPTEUR,
        d.ID_CAPTURE as ID_CAPTURE,
        d.VALEUR_CAPTURE as valeur,
        d.DATE_CAPTURE,
        t.INTITULE_TYPE_CAPTURE as TYPE_CAPTURE,
        z.INTITULE_ZONE as zone,
        r.INTITULE_REGION as region
    from CAPTEUR c, CAPTURE d, TYPECAPTURE t, ZONE z, REGION r
    where c.ID_CAPTEUR=d.ID_CAPTEUR
          and d.ID_TYPE_CAPTURE=t.ID_TYPE_CAPTURE
          and c.ID_ZONE = z.ID_ZONE
          and z.ID_REGION = r.ID_REGION
我得到这个错误:

1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'as select c.ID_CAPTEUR as ID_CAPTEUR , d.ID_CAPTURE as ID_CAPTURE , d.VALEUR_CAP' at line 1
以下是该语句的语法:

CREATE
[OR REPLACE]
[ALGORITHM = {UNDEFINED | MERGE | TEMPTABLE}]
[DEFINER = { user | CURRENT_USER }]
[SQL SECURITY { DEFINER | INVOKER }]
VIEW view_name [(column_list)]
AS select_statement
[WITH [CASCADED | LOCAL] CHECK OPTION]

如您所见,您的查询缺少
view\u name
参数(
[
]
之间的参数是可选的,这与
view\u name
的情况不同)。

想想,您以后将如何引用此视图?您需要提供一个视图名称